Did  you know that it’s really simple to find the housing office as well as a website where you can see floor plans or actual pictures of housing ?

Many spouses always ask for help finding housing so I thought I would explain to you in a sentence or two how to do that.

Simply put…Google :)

No actually visiting Google and typing in Your Duty Station and Housing will usually come up with the correct results.

My last simple tip is that military housing is now privatized so when you do searches you will usually see names like Balfour Beatty, Picerne and Pinnacle. Those are just to name a few.
